As for transportation options, you can fly into Portland, rent a car a drive over, OR you could fly into Redmond Oregon which is only about 20 minutes from Bend. Usually it's more expensive to fly into Redmond but it saves you the gas money of the 2.5 hour drive to Bend from PDX. Once you get to Bend you could feasibly not use your car at all because everything you would want is walking/riding distance.
